  • Surgeons at the helm, always: The robot doesn’t perform your surgery—the surgeon does. Think of it as a highly advanced tool that enhances the surgeon’s control and precision. During your procedure, your surgeon is at the helm, maneuvering every movement and using a magnified, three-dimensional HD view of the surgical area to perform delicate, intricate procedures with unmatched accuracy.

General Surgery

  • Gallbladder removal (cholecystectomy)
  • Appendectomy
  • Hernia repair
  • Bariatric surgery (e.g., gastric bypass, sleeve gastrectomy)
  • Adrenal surgery
  • Liver surgery

The latest technology

At Virtua, you'll find the latest robotic-assisted surgical equipment in more of our operating rooms than other health systems. The “da Vinci Surgical System” replicates your surgeon’s hand movements in real-time. This includes the most advanced surgical robot, the da Vinci 5, which offers improved accuracy and precision, first-of-its-kind technology, and better outcomes. For orthopedic procedures, we also utilize the Mako SmartRobotics™, which allows for greater precision in knee and hip replacements, helping preserve healthy bone and tissue.
